6. A balloon filled with air has a volume of 3.25 L at 30°C. It is placed in a freezer at
Viefleur [7K]

Answer:

2.82 L

T₁ = 303 K

T₂ = 263 K

The final volume is smaller.

Explanation:

Step 1: Given data

  • Initial temperature (T₁): 30 °C
  • Initial volume (V₁): 3.25 L
  • Final temperature (T₂): -10 °C
  • Final volume (V₂): ?

Step 2: Convert the temperatures to Kelvin

We will use the following expression.

K = °C + 273.15

T₁: K = 30°C + 273.15 = 303 K

T₂: K = -10°C + 273.15 = 263 K

Step 3: Calculate the final volume of the balloon

Assuming constant pressure and ideal behavior, we can calculate the final volume using Charles' law. Since the temperature is smaller, the volume must be smaller as well.

V₁/T₁ = V₂/T₂

V₂ = V₁ × T₂/T₁

V₂ = 3.25 L × 263 K/303 K = 2.82 L
